DN <br />IF*JO% <br />/October 29, 2014 <br />COLORADO <br />Division of Reclamation, <br />Mining and Safety <br />Department of Natural Resources <br />1313 Sherman Street, Room 215 <br />Denver, CO 80203 <br />Kenneth Schaaf <br />VITC Resources, LLC <br />PO Box 563 <br />Delta, CO 81416 <br />i- ti D ! <br />p.xalp►-017 <br />Re: Honey Badger - Vulcan Exploration Project, NOI No. P- 2014 -017, All Deficiencies Addressed, <br />Financial Warranty Accepted <br />Dear Mr. Schaaf, <br />The Division of Reclamation, Mining and Safety (Division) has received the final necessary financial <br />warranty documents that were submitted by you on behalf of the Applicant, Honey Badger Resources, <br />LLC, and has found that there are no further deficiencies with this prospecting NOI. This finding is <br />effective as of the date of this letter. <br />The Division has estimated the reclamation costs for this project, and considers the $2,000 bond provided <br />to be sufficient. Please see the enclosed packet of reclamation costs and notify me promptly if you notice <br />any errors or omissions. <br />The Division finds the financial warranty acceptable and sufficient, and the NOI is fully approved. <br />This is your notice that prospecting activity may commence. <br />Please provide copy of this letter and enclosed packet of reclamation costs to the Applicant.
